**Mgmt Meeting Minutes — Retiring the Brightline Range**

Quick recap for sales leads at Fenholt Supplies: we agreed to retire the Brightline fixture range by year-end. Remaining stock moves to clearance pricing next month, and accounts on standing orders get migrated to the Lumetta range. Trade-in incentives were approved in principle. The confidential note on next steps sits just below.

board note of bajof-bajeg: The pricing group signed off on a budget of $13.4 million for Project Sildor. The renewal with Lamixek Holdings closes at $48.9 million a year, 49 percent above the last contract.

Ticket: Staging env misconfigured for Siftgate bloom filter

The bloom layer in front of the Pellet KV store is rejecting all lookups in staging because the env file was copied from the dev template without credentials. False-positive tuning values are fine; only the auth line is missing. To unblock the weekly demo, the Pellet admission secret must be set on the following line.

env line for yaguf-fajop: LEDGER_TOKEN13=fb08984397349

## Formula sandbox tuning

User-supplied formulas in Gridmoor execute inside a restricted interpreter with hard ceilings on time, memory, and call depth. Reviewers should confirm any change to these ceilings is justified in the PR description, since raising them widens the abuse surface. Defaults were chosen from production traces. The current limits are as follows.

limits module of tafog-fawip:
WEIGHTS = {
    "julix": 57,
    "lamys": 992,
    "kasvan": 209,
    "quenok": 750,
    "alddor": 259,
    "oliath": 1009,
    "wenix": 815,
}

Every Tilefetch artifact shipped to the Marrowgate CDN is built on the sealed runner pool, never on developer laptops. The pipeline records the source revision, dependency lockfile hash, and runner image digest in a provenance manifest attached to the artifact. As a contractor, you verify an artifact by comparing its manifest against the registry entry before deploying. Unsigned artifacts must be rejected regardless of who requests the deploy. Each verified build is identified by the token printed beneath this line.

build token for fajof-yahof: htk4_869f